The axolotl coincidence

A busy day back at the ranch, lots of meetings and of course, no time for lunch (hmph) because my implementation of scheduled lunch breaks hasn't kicked in yet.  Make of that what you will.

At one point in the afternoon, I was having a text conversation with L about Folkie and I got confused, because there was a mention of acolytes. "Did you mean acolytes?" I said, wondering about Folkie's secret religion that I'd possibly missed the memo on.  "No" she said, and after a pause "axolotls". Good old auto-correct. So we had a giggle and an exchange of axolotl GIFS.

Running later than planned from my last meeting, I just missed the train I was aiming for and ended up waiting for the next one (15 mins later).  I had been listening to an audio book but realised I wasn't really actually listening to it, so I stopped and allowed my mind to wander.  I started re-reading the earlier text conversation and as I looked up from my phone, I absolutely promise you, the next person who walked onto the platform was carrying a cuddly pink axolotl toy wearing a disposable mask (the axolotl not the person).  Sometimes you cannot make life up.  I don't know what Folkie is up too, but she's having a bloody good giggle at this mischief somewhere today.

Blip: Sometimes the Universe is telling you to look at the bigger picture in order to enjoy it in all its madness.  I didn't ask to take a picture of the axolotl toy because frankly, there are not many conversational openers to "nice axolotl, can I take its picture on my phone?" that didn't sound weird in my head, so I decided to combine my thoughts and take the thing that most resembled an axolotl in close-up my garden*.  The bigger picture, of course, reveals what it is...**

*Clearly this plant in no way resembles an axolotl but I'd like some credit for trying.

** Feel like this might be the most number of times anyone has ever written the word axolotl in one page, with the exception  JR Hartleys "Compendium of Axolotls Part IV”
